Electronics

Students will be allowed to use Internet


enabled devices at my discretion. We will
use these tools as a resource for
educational purposes ONLY! School issued
iPad use will be monitored to make sure that
students are on task.

Cell phones & iPods will not be used freely
in my room. Classrooms are for education,
and they will be used only if the lesson
requires them to be utilized. Other times
they will stay in your childs bag, pocket, or
an area that I designate for devices.

Late work Policy
- Students must complete and return
assignments on time.

- After the due date, students will have 3 days
to turn the missing assignment in, 10 points
will be deducted for each day late. Students
will be assigned an Academic Lunch to
make up the missing assignment. An M
should be entered in the gradebook to notify
parents of the missing assignment.

- A Tuesday School will be assigned to
students that have not completed the missing
assignment within 2 days of having Academic
Lunch.

- After 3 days, a 0 will be entered into the
gradebook; a notation should be listed beside
the grade that it was not turned in.
Students will have 1 day for every
absence/extra-curricular absence to make up
any assignments or exams.

- Students will have 1 week from the time a
test or assignment is given back to retake the
test or assignment for a high grade of a 70
(unless otherwise noted on a students IEP).
